Two officers are recovering with minor injuries after their car was rammed in Banbridge.
It happened on Saturday when they attended a call where a driver had been blocked in by another.
As the officers arrived a vehicle drove straight at them.
They were able to restrain and arrest the driver for dangerous driving and resisting arrest.
